All News Sport Culture Lifestyle Huge cheers as King Charles hails importance of 'checks and balances' on executive power Buckingham Palace said the King was “greatly touched by the warmth and generosity” of US Congress ’s response to his speech. A Palace spokesperson said: “ The King was deeply honoured to have been invited to be the first British King to give such an address and was greatly touched by the warmth and generosity of the response he received.” Charles said the partnership between the two nations is “more important today than it has ever been”. The attempted assassination of President Donald Trump at a Washington media dinner on Saturday evening was condemned by the King who said “such acts of violence will never succeed.” Concluding his speech with “God bless the United States and the United Kingdom”, members of Congress rose to give a standing ovation.…
